I'm Ganzengeile from Switzerland and I've joined Sokker in June 2005.
From the beginning I was fascinated by the tactical possibilities you have here, and soon Sokker became number 1 among the online games for me.

I don't want to talk much about my career as club manager, I promoted on the direct way to Super League and I'm still playing there, from time to time winning the championship (like this season).
But I don't really think that success as a club manager implies success as a NT coach, that's why I don't want to talk more about my club team.
(If you want to know more, here are my chronicle)


I was Swiss NT coach for three seasons and it was so much fun that I decided to run for a NT election again!

I took over the Swiss team after it failed in the WC qualifications, so I had one season to get accustomed to the NT life. In this season I also qualified for the u21 WC.

The second season was the WC qualification, we managed it with 27 points out of 10 matches, beating Nederland as the highlight.

Finally the WC was a little bit a dissapointment (even though we were the weakest team of our group), we couldn't go through the group stage, but at least we beat Spain (later finalist) in a perfect match.
In the same season Switzerland got to the quarter finals of the u21 WC ...

In the end I took Switzerland over somewhere among position 40, and when I retired we were 22nd.


I can't tell you much about my preffered tactics, I have to admit that I only have watched a few NT matches when Nin was in charge of the NT, so at the moment I don't now where the strengths and weaknesses are in the Irish team ... :-(
But anyway, you have to find out where the weakness of your opponent is and thus your tactic has to rely on your opponent's tactic.
But what I can say is that my motto is: "defense first"! ;-)

Next season I would join the u21 WC qualification, and in between I would try to find the formation for the WC qualification in two seasons.

I definitely can assure you that I will try everything to achieve good results and that this candidature is meant seriously!
